Rurki
Rurki is a village located in Amloh tehsil of Fatehgarh Sahib district in Punjab,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Amloh (tehsildar office) and 31km away from district headquarter Fatehgarh Sahib. As per 2009 stats, Rurki village is also a gram panchayat.

About Rurki
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rurki is 032832. The village spans a total geographical area of 378 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 147203. Amloh is nearest town to Rurki village for all major economic activities.

Population of Rurki
Below is a concise population overview of Rurki as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,266 | 670 | 596 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 147 | 83 | 64 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 436 | 235 | 201 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 845 | 475 | 370 |
Illiterate Population | 421 | 195 | 226 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Rurki village:
- The total population of Rurki village is around 1,266, including approximately 670 males and 596 females, with a sex ratio of 889 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 147 children aged 0–6 years in Rurki village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Rurki village has 436 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Rurki village is about 66.75%, with male literacy at 70.90% and female literacy at 62.08%.
- There are around 231 households in Rurki village.
Connectivity of Rurki
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rurki. As per the 2011 stats, Rurki had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
